The Effect Of Inonotus Obliquus Polysaccharide On Gut Immunity And Insulin Metabolism Of Drosophila Melanogaster

Inonotus obliquus(Fr.)Pilat is a precious and rare medicinal fungus,known to be effective for the prevention and treatment of such incurable diseases as cancer and diabetes.In addition,Drosophila melanogaster s an efficient model with such advantages as short life cycle and low cost for the bioactivity evaluation of traditional Chinese medicine.In this study,the effects of I.obliquus polysaccharide on gut immunity and insulin metabolism of D.melanogaster were investigated through toxic reagent-induced gut damage and intestinal stem cell(ISC)tumor models and high sucrose diet(HSD)-induced and insulin signaling pathway-mutated diabetes models by analyzing survival rate,number of dead cells,reactive oxygen species(ROS),Diptericin expression,ISC proliferation and differentiation,percentage of flies with tumor and growth indices such as pupa size and adult body weight.1.The polysaccharide ameliorated toxic reagent-induced Drosophila survival rate decrease and excessive gut epithelial cell death and alleviate not only the enhanced ROS and Diptericin levels and the excessive ISC proliferation and differentiation due to the gut damage but also the ISC tumorigenesis induced by the combination of tissue stress and ISC differentiation loss.2.The polysaccharide was proved to ameliorate the reductions at growth indices in HSD-fed Drosophila and chico mutant but not in S6k mutant.This study provides a theoretical basis for the further research on the detailed mechanism of I.obliquus polysaccharide.
